当前位置: 代码迷 >> C语言 >> 关于指针数组的问题
  详细解决方案

关于指针数组的问题

热度:99   发布时间:2007-10-29 18:31:41.0
回复:(wtyj112)c语言不允许你定义这样的数组啊除非...
那C中的指针数组不就没有意义了吗?
那为什么要弄个这种数组出来....
----------------解决方案--------------------------------------------------------
怎么样它都应该有个最大值
真正任意长度数组是不可能实现的
能实现的可能就是一个假象的 任意长度 但是总有个最大值的
----------------解决方案--------------------------------------------------------
c语言 缺点很多 不要以为流行的就是好东西
建议你看看c专家编程这本书 让你看看c语言的一些真面目。
----------------解决方案--------------------------------------------------------
你要的那种算法 可以用malloc来实现啊
就是没输入一个字符串 调用库函数得到它的长度
然后把这个长度作为 参数传给malloc函数 来实现开辟空间 然后把首地址放到指针数组中去

不就可以了。

能达到你要的效果
----------------解决方案--------------------------------------------------------
以下是引用wtyj112在2007-10-29 18:43:49的发言:
c语言 缺点很多 不要以为流行的就是好东西
建议你看看c专家编程这本书 让你看看c语言的一些真面目。

好的,再次感谢


----------------解决方案--------------------------------------------------------
回复:(chmlqw)15楼,什么是NEW操作......[em04]
不好意思啊。我说的是C++里的,内存分配操作关健字。
----------------解决方案--------------------------------------------------------
.........
----------------解决方案--------------------------------------------------------
  相关解决方案